Physical Attributes of King Brown Snakes
Appearance and Size
The King Brown Snake is renowned for its impressive dimension, often getting to sizes as much as 3 meters (10 feet). Its pigmentation varies from gold brown to dark chocolate tones, which permits it to mix effortlessly into its environment.
Behavioral Traits
These snakes are understood for their hostile nature when endangered. They tend to be a lot more active during warmer months and can usually be seen basking in the sun.
Physical Features of Tiger Snakes
Distinctive Markings
The Tiger Serpent gets its name from the tiger-like stripes that decorate its body. Ranging from yellowish-brown to dark olive or black, these red stripes can differ substantially amongst individuals.
Size Variation
Typically smaller than King Browns, Tiger Snakes grow up to 1.5 meters (5 feet) long but can still position substantial dangers due to their potent venom.
Geographical Circulation: Where Are They Found?
King Brown Serpent Habitat
Primarily located across north and eastern Australia, King Browns inhabit a range of environments varying from forests to city areas where they look for sanctuary under View website particles or rocks.

Tiger Snake Habitat
Tiger Snakes choose seaside regions and marshes; they are frequently located near estuaries, swamps, and even verdant fields beside water bodies.
